"How does homeopathy differ from conventional medicine? Homeopathy differs from conventional medicine in several ways. Physicians of the past have learned and taught us that we all have an energy within us to heal ourselves. Called "vital force", Ancient physicians were familiar with this natural power of the organism to control disease and they invented for it a beautiful expression: "Vis medicratrix naturae" (healing power of nature). This force is always at work to keep our bodies in balance. According to homeopathy, symptoms are a reflection of this disturbed vital force. We need to understand that symptoms are the bodies natural way of trying to heal itself. Homeopathic medicine is aimed at correcting the disturbed vital force and thus enhances the power of the body to heal itself. Conventional medicine treats the symptoms only, such as a cough by suppressing it with various means. Conventional medicine, therefore tries to control the illness (symptoms) through the regular use of medicinal substances. Once these medicines are stopped, the symptoms (illness) returns. Homeopathy takes the cough as well as other symptoms and finds a remedy that will stimulate the ill body to restore itself to health. In conventional medicine thought, health is seen simply as the absence of disease. In homeopathy, health is much more than that! I am deeply grateful for the science, art, and wisdom of homeopathy.
